Enovix's P/B and P/E Ratios Are Higher Than Average:
Enovix Corporation designs, develops, and manufactures lithium-ion battery cells in the United States and internationally. The company belongs to the Industrials sector, which has an average price to earnings (P/E) ratio of 24.03 and an average price to book (P/B) ratio of 2.89. In contrast, Enovix has a trailing 12 month P/E ratio of -14.1 and a P/B ratio of 12.8.
Enovix has moved -19.8% over the last year compared to 10.6% for the S&P 500 — a difference of -30.4%. Enovix has a 52 week high of $18.68 and a 52 week low of $5.27.
